Understanding Drift Mechanics

Before diving into techniques, it’s crucial to understand the fundamentals of drifting. Drifting involves deliberately oversteering the car, causing a loss of traction in the rear wheels while maintaining control through steering. It can be used to navigate sharp turns faster or to showcase skills during car meets. Becoming proficient at this requires practice, technique, and the right vehicle settings.

Choosing the Right Vehicle

Your vehicle plays a significant role in your drifting experience. Not all cars handle drifting equally well. Select cars that are known for their drift capabilities, such as:

  • Nissan Silvia S15
  • Toyota AE86
  • Mazda RX-7

These vehicles often have a balanced weight distribution and rear-wheel-drive, enhancing your drifting capabilities.

Vehicle Modifications for Drifting

Modifying your vehicle can enhance its performance for drifting. Consider these crucial upgrades:

  1. Tires: Opt for tires that provide a balance between grip and sliding capability.
  2. Suspension: Upgrading to coilovers can improve handling and stability during drifts.
  3. Differential: Installing a limited-slip differential can help maintain control during high-speed maneuvers.

Mastering Basic Drifting Techniques

1. The Clutch Kick

The clutch kick is a common technique used to initiate a drift. Here’s how to perform it:

  • Accelerate to your desired speed.
  • Press the clutch pedal while simultaneously revving the engine.
  • Release the clutch quickly while turning into the corner, causing the rear wheels to lose traction.

This technique requires timing and precision but is essential for initiating drifts more effectively.

2. Handbrake Drifting

Using the handbrake can also help you initiate a drift, particularly in tighter turns:

  • Approach the turn at a moderate speed.
  • Pull the handbrake while turning into the corner.
  • As the rear begins to slide, counter-steer to maintain control.

This method can be particularly useful in tight corners, making it a valuable addition to your drifting repertoire.

3. Throttle Control

Mastering throttle control is vital to maintaining a drift. Here are some tips:

  • Feathering: Lightly modulating the throttle during a drift can help maintain momentum and prevent spinning out.
  • Power Over: Increase throttle during a drift to bring more power to the rear wheels, allowing for sharper turns.

Keep practicing these techniques, and you’ll find the perfect balance between acceleration and control during a drift.

Advanced Drifting Techniques

Once you’ve mastered the basics, you can explore more advanced drifting techniques. These methods will require practice and a keen understanding of your vehicle’s dynamics.

1. Initiation via Shift Lock

Shift locking involves downshifting while turning to induce a drift. This requires practice to achieve effectively:

  • Accelerate toward a corner.
  • Downshift quickly while steering into the turn.
  • This technique causes the rear wheels to lose traction, initiating a drift.

2. The Scandinavian Flick

Perfect for high-speed turns, the Scandinavian flick helps you change direction quickly:

  • Approach the turn slightly off to one side.
  • Flick the steering wheel in the opposite direction.
  • Follow by turning into the corner while applying throttle.

This method allows for sharper turns and can be particularly effective in racing scenarios.

3. Using Weight Transfer

Understanding weight transfer can greatly improve your drifting skills. Here’s how to utilize it:

  • Before entering a corner, shift your weight by braking or accelerating.
  • This method helps to make the rear of the car lighter, allowing it to slide more easily.

4. Maintaining Momentum

Momentum is crucial while drifting. Always try to maintain a smooth and consistent speed throughout the drift to avoid losing control. Slow down slightly before entering the turn, and then accelerate through the drift.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Even seasoned players can fall into common drifting traps. Here are some mistakes to watch out for:

  1. Oversteering: It’s natural to counter-steer, but overdoing it can lead to losing control. Practice sensitivity in your steering inputs.
  2. Inadequate Throttle Control: Too much throttle can result in spinning out. Learn to modulate the throttle effectively.
  3. Ignoring Setup: Poor vehicle setups can severely limit your drifting abilities. Always ensure your setup is optimized for drifting.
